What Data We Collect on sumo77

We collect information in several categories when you register and use our platform. Your account registration data includes your full legal name, email address, date of birth, and residential address. These details are necessary for account creation and verification.

When you fund your sumo77 account, we collect payment information — specifically, the payment method you choose (DANA, e-wallet, mobile banking, local payment, online payment, e-wallet, mobile banking, local payment, online payment, or e-wallet), your bank account or e-wallet identifier, and transaction amounts and dates. Our payment processors handle the actual card or bank details; we do not store unencrypted credit-card numbers or full bank account credentials in our primary systems.

We collect device and usage data — your IP address, device type (Android, iOS, or desktop), browser type, and approximate geographic location inferred from your IP. We also record your login times, the games you access, the bets you place, and your account balance history. This data helps us detect fraud, troubleshoot technical issues, and understand which features are most used.

Identity verification: Before you can withdraw from sumo77, we collect a scan or photograph of your government-issued ID (national identity card, passport, or driving licence) and a proof-of-residence document.

We may collect additional data if you contact our support team — your inquiry content, our responses, and any documentation you provide. If you participate in promotional campaigns or surveys, we collect your responses.

Fraud Detection and Compliance

We analyze your account activity, IP address, and device information to detect suspicious patterns — such as rapid consecutive deposits and withdrawals, logins from multiple locations in implausibly short timeframes, or collusion with other accounts. This analysis helps us prevent fraud and money-laundering. If we detect suspicious activity, we may restrict your account, request additional verification, or file reports with relevant authorities as required by law.

Data Security and Storage

We at sumo77 protect your data using industry-standard encryption (SSL/TLS for data in transit, AES-256 for data at rest). Our servers are located in secure data centers with physical access controls, intrusion detection, and continuous monitoring. We conduct annual security audits and maintain backups to ensure data recovery in case of system failure.

Our servers may be located outside your country — for example, in the United States, European Union, or Singapore. By accessing sumo77, you acknowledge that your data may be transferred to and processed in jurisdictions outside Indonesia. These jurisdictions may have different data protection standards than your home country.

We retain your data for as long as your sumo77 account is active. After you close your account, we retain transaction records and identification documents for seven years to comply with anti-money-laundering regulations. After seven years, we delete or anonymize your data, except where law requires longer retention.

Cookies and Tracking Technologies

Our sumo77 platform uses cookies and similar tracking technologies to enhance your experience. Session cookies allow us to keep you logged in and maintain your preferences during your visit. Persistent cookies remember your login details (if you choose to stay logged in) and your language preference. We also use analytics cookies to track which pages you visit and how long you spend on each, helping us understand user behavior and optimize our platform.

You can control cookies through your browser settings — most browsers allow you to disable cookies or be notified when a cookie is placed. However, disabling cookies may limit your ability to use certain sumo77 features. We do not use third-party advertising cookies, so our tracking is limited to operational and analytical purposes.
